Kodak uses threats to get you to fork over cash


I have used Kodak Gallery to share photos with Friends.
It was a Free service and I thought that it was pretty good. I personally haven't bought any prints though.
I know that my sister has.
Today I get an Email from them letting me know that they will burn my photos if I don't pay up.
Because you currently do not meet the minimum purchase requirement established by our new storage policy, your stored photos will be deleted from your Gallery account if you do not act soon.
Here is your current status:
Current photo storage:2.10 GB
Purchase requirement:$19.99
Amount you have spent:$0.00
Amount you need to spend:$19.99
Deletion date:05/16/2009

So if I buy $20.00 worth of Coffee mugs and 4 x6's they'll put the matches down, but only for a year.
I think that they pretty much lost any chance of ever selling a camera to me in the future.

EpochTime


Its getting closer!
Eventually it will read 1234567890! (Friday, February 13th 2009, 23:31:30 UTC)

Good thing someone built a counter.
Here it is.

What the heck is Epoch time anyhow?

"The Unix epoch is the time 00:00:00 UTC on January 1, 1970."
Of course Excel uses the number of days since 1/1/1900, so the Excel date code of 123456789 won't be here until 03/16/12233. Probably not gonna make that one.
